Description: ***Jacuzzi will be closed for renovations from 10/23/07 through 11/9/2007*** This attractive New Mexico hotel in Gallup lies in the heart of geologic natural wonders and Native American culture! Travelers get it all when making reservations at the Best Western Inn & Suites: proximity to local culture, natural parks and geologic wonders while still being close to the conveniences of city life. This hotel offers the comforts of home, including a complimentary full hot breakfast buffet, on-site restaurant, cocktail lounge and an indoor pool. The New Mexico Steakhouse, located on the premises, is open daily for breakfast and dinner. Offering a wide array of spirits, the adjacent Rookie Sports Bar is open most days for after-dinner drinks or casual get-togethers. Every over-sized room offers free high-speed Internet access. Guests can upgrade to rooms equipped with a microwave, refrigerator or an executive suite. Located in Gallup, New Mexico, the city is the trading hub of western American Indian arts and crafts. Travelers flock to the Best Western Inn to see an exotic array of traditional and modern jewelry, rugs, carvings, sand paintings and fine art. Seasonal festivals and ceremonies include the annual Inter-Tribal Indian Ceremonial, the annual Route 66 Festival and the Native American Film Festival. | Area Attractions | Nearby Cities:
60 mile(s) from Grants 125 mile(s) from Albuquerque 127 mile(s) from Flagstaff, AZ 127 mile(s) from Farmington 150 mile(s) from Santa Fe 280 mile(s) from Kingman, AZ 286 mile(s) from Phoenix, AZ 390 mile(s) from Amarillo, TXLocal Attractions:
1 to 5 miles from Trading Posts - Great deals on Indian Jewelry 4 mile(s) from Movie Magic Old Western Stars El Rancho Hotel, Historic District and Downtown 7 mile(s) from Red Mesa Art Gallery 10 mile(s) from Red Rock Museum, Red Rock State Park. Home of the Red Rock Balloon Rally - 1st weekend of December. 25 mile(s) from Window Rock, The Navajo Nation's Capitol 30 mile(s) from Zuni Indian Pueblo , Clay ovens and homes are part of the quaint features of the Zuni Pueblo. Some ceremonies are open to the public. 40 mile(s) from Blue Water Lake State Park , (fishing), El Morro National Monument where the ancient Acoma Indians and the Zuni Indians met to trade their wares. Explore the petroglyphs of the Native Americans and Conquistadores and re-live the history of New Mexico. 80 mile(s) from Chaco Canyon, home of the ancient Anasazi Indians. This area is a discovery of your own. The Anasazi Indians have long been considered the originating tribes of the Navajo Nation, Acoma, Zuni, and Laguna Indians. 90 mile(s) from Painted Desert , Petrified Forest 95 mile(s) from Canyon De Chelley Last weekend of May to first weekend of September - Free nightly Indian dancing at train station Weekend in October - Gallup Film Festival First weekend of September is your chance to experience Indian Country at the Navajo Nation FairLocal Attractions:
